Summer Reading Program 2008
581 kids and 67 teens completed at least 10 hours of reading for a total of 648 finishers. Well done. We are proud of you!
Reading Buddy Volunteers
made a big difference in the lives of families with young children this summer. Twenty volunteers ages 9 to 17 offered over 75 hours of service to our community through reading aloud to young children at our library. See photos of our volunteers in action below.
Popular demand means that we will bring our Reading Buddy program back next summer. If you are interested in serving as a volunteer, we will offer an orientation in June 2009. Stay tuned.

The Friends support library activities, library staff and library customers in a variety of ways. They are especially interested in those related towards children and young adult reading, and the Inquiring Mind series. Memorial donations to the Friends are used to purchase special and appropriate books. The Friends were instrumental in helping to establish the library capital facilities area and supporting the successful levy. They helped both monetarily and with donated labor during the library enlargement and remodel. The downstairs meeting room space was finished primarily through the efforts of the North Kitsap Friends of the Library and other local service organizations. The room is scheduled and rented by many local groups through the city of Poulsbo ’s Parks and Recreation department. The art committee of the Friends selected art purchased by funds raised by the Friends to be placed throughout the library. They continue to add pieces for the enjoyment of all visitors to the library. The Friends helped with the landscaping around the library building, which was originally funded by a generous donor. Several of them continue to work diligently on the grounds.
